WebJan 29, 2024 · People born in Northern Ireland have the right to identify themselves as British, Irish, or both, as declared in the Belfast/Good Friday Agreement. This includes the right to hold both British and Irish citizenship, if eligible. Citizenship rights are determined by the UK and Ireland separately; dual citizenship is not an automatic birthright.
